Puerto Vallarta Today

The Latest News and Trends in One of Mexico's Most Vibrant Cities

Puerto Vallarta, a popular tourist destination located on the Pacific coast of Mexico, is a vibrant city with a rich culture and a lively media landscape. Here are some of the top headline news stories making waves in Puerto Vallarta today:

  1. Tourism and Travel: As a major destination for both domestic and international tourists, tourism and travel-related news is always a hot topic in Puerto Vallarta. With the COVID-19 pandemic affecting travel around the world, the city has seen a significant drop in tourism, leading to economic challenges for many businesses and residents.

  2. Crime and Security: Like many cities in Mexico, Puerto Vallarta has faced challenges with crime and security in recent years. The government has implemented various measures to combat the problem, including increased police presence and community-based programs, but concerns over safety remain a top priority for many residents and visitors.

  3. Infrastructure and Development: Puerto Vallarta is a growing city, with ongoing development projects and infrastructure improvements. However, some residents have raised concerns about the impact of development on the city’s natural resources and cultural heritage, as well as the potential for overdevelopment to negatively affect the city’s tourism industry.

  4. Environmental Issues: Puerto Vallarta is home to a diverse range of natural environments, including beaches, jungles, and mountains. However, these environments are threatened by climate change, pollution, and other environmental issues. Many residents and environmental groups have been advocating for more sustainable and responsible practices to protect the city’s natural resources.

  5. Social Issues: Like many cities in Mexico, Puerto Vallarta has a complex social landscape, with issues related to poverty, inequality, and discrimination. Local groups and activists are working to address these issues and create more equitable and inclusive communities.
